Houston, TX – Hastings Law Firm, Medical Malpractice Lawyers has in its recent research uncovered some facts regarding medical malpractice as a type of personal injury in the United States.

In the latest research work carried out by the lawyers, the attorneys pointed out medical errors as one of the leading causes of deaths among United States residents. The present study carried out by the law firm revealed that over 250,000 people lose their lives annually on account of the mistakes made by medical professionals.

Ranking third among the leading causes of death in the United States, medical malpractice has indeed become a scourge.

Further in the “how common is medical malpractice” research article, the TX medical malpractice lawyers noted that the low number of medical malpractice cases may be attributed to the lack of a standardized method for collecting national statistics. The research article further pointed out that with the public being generally unaware of medical malpractices and how to spot them, many have died and without their families getting the deserved amount in compensation.

Further throwing light on the subject matter, the medical injury lawyers revealed in the research article the key elements required in proving medical malpractice. As contained in the research article, the TX law requires the existence of a doctor-patient relationship or some other duty of care; the doctor or hospital is required to be proven to have been negligent in carrying out their primary duties.
